Frequent Shopify Appearance Mistakes (and How to Fix Them)
Many aspiring Shopify store owners inadvertently fall into several aesthetic pitfalls that can seriously affect their shop's reputation. These typical issues often stem from a absence of experience or merely not understanding best methods. Here's a brief look at some of the primary difficult ones, and methods to address them.
- Poor Image Quality: Employing blurry or low-quality images deters customers. Substitute them with crisp images.
- Confusing Navigation: If users don't quickly find what they’re looking for, they’ll leave. Streamline your menu structure.
- Excessive Clutter: A crowded site is challenging to view. Minimize the amount of elements.
- Conflicting Branding: Mismatched aesthetics and fonts create a amateurish feel. Ensure brand coherence.
- Device Incompatibility: Verify your store looks great on all platforms. Use a responsive theme.
Note that a thoughtful Shopify store boosts trust and increases sales.
